"Feel It Boy" is a 2002 single by deejay
Beenie Man from the album Tropical Storm.
The music video was directed by Dave Meyers. Set
on an island beach, it depicts different
characters in their daily life with Jackson and
Beenie Man on the beach enjoying the surroundings
and different activities around them. Towards the
end, Beenie Man pulls in a fourwheeler near Janet
and begins to eye her with binoculars. The video
ends with a party that was mentioned in the song.
The video was filmed on Westward Beach in Malibu,
California.
The song was written by Beenie Man and produced
by award-winning duo The Neptunes. It was released
as a single on September 16, 2002, peaking in the
top 20's and 30's in most countries. It
spent 12 weeks on the Billboard Hot 100 peaking at
#28. It also peaked at #9 on the UK Singles
Chart.
However, its release also sparked controversy, as
UK g*y Rights group OutRage! called for a boycott
of the single, citing Beenie Man's
"history of homophobic dancehall lyrics."
In 2004, Jackson expressed her regret for the
duet, saying "If I had known that (he was
associated with homophobia), I would not have
worked with him. It's shocking to me.
We're on the same label, so I should have
known. But at the same time, I wish someone from
the company would have told me, knowing how... I
feel about the g*y community." The song
appeared in the Japan-only radio promo sampler We
Love Janet in 2006.
Tropical Storm is reggae, dancehall artist Beenie
Man's 12th studio album. It was released on
August, 20, 2002. The album is a mix of dancehall
and reggae fusion, with hit singles such as
"Feel It Boy" featuring R&B singer
Janet Jackson and "Bossman" featuring
dancehall artists Lady Saw & Sean Paul.
Anthony Moses Davis (born August 22, 1973),
better known by his stage name Beenie Man, is a
grammy award winning Jamaican reggae artist.
In 2002, he had a sizeable hit with a duet with
Janet Jackson called "Feel It Boy", but
his biggest break in America came in early 2004
with the release of a remix of "Dude",
featuring guest vocals by fellow Jamaican Ms.
Thing, as well as rhymes by Shawnna. He thus
cemented his fan base on both sides of the
Atlantic.
He had hits in the UK in 1998 with "Who am
I" (#10), in 2003 with "Street Life"
(#13) and "Feel It Boy" (UK #9), a duet
with Janet Jackson, and in 2004 with
"Dude" (#7) and "King of the
Dancehall" (#14).
He was also a judge for the 6th annual
Independent Music Awards to support independent
artists' careers.
In April 2008 it was announced that Beenie Man
was to co-write and star in the film Kingston.

In September 2008 Beenie Man was cleared of
charges of tax evasion.
In April 2009, Beenie Man signed with Brookland
Entertainment, a new record label formed by Eric
Nicks and The Trackmasters, in preparation to
release his new album, "The Legend
Returns". The music video for the release of
his new single
